L6060: Just started happening today. When you push the joystick forward to lower the bucket - it's as if the float function release is "catching" the lift will lower very slowly. Cycling the joystick seems to make it let go and operate properly. But it's back to the hanging up the next time you try to lower the bucket. No problem in raise or curl/dump only in lower..... any ideas?

Check to make sure all the nuts & bolts are tight on the joints under the joystick.
If nothing came loose, it might be moisture or debris built up inside the valve cup under the float valve.
